CVC Info
Columbia Volleyball Club (columbiavolleyballclub.org) is a not‑for‑profit organization of Washington‑Baltimore‑Annapolis area volleyball enthusiasts including student athletes, coaches, referees, adult helpers and parents from more than 90 families. Participating student‑athletes are girls ages 10 to 18. While based in Columbia, Maryland, we typically have players from more than a dozen high schools and several middle and elementary schools in Anne Arundel, Baltimore, Carroll, Howard, Montgomery and Prince George's counties in Maryland.

Columbia Volleyball Club was founded in 1985 with 20 players and a single coach. During 2004 the Club fielded nine teams with over 90 players, 21 coaches and several dozen actively involved parents. The Club and student‑athletes belong to and are sanctioned by USA Volleyball (USAV), a  national association. 

The Club's mission for the older age groups is to improve the player's skills and knowledge of the game through competition that far surpasses the level of high school play in our area. The mission is also to instill values of team play, individual discipline and work habits which will serve them well in any future endeavor. For those student‑athletes who have the academic and volleyball skills, and the desire and dedication to play in college, the Club also assists players seeking scholarship opportunities.

The Club's mission for the younger age groups is developmentally based   This mission is to teach fundamental volleyball skills, to encourage interest and enthusiasm for the sport, and to instill values of individual discipline and team play.
